First you need to generate ssl certificates (only once)
sudo mkdir -p /srv/certs/
cd /srv/certs/
echo -e "CASUBJ=\"/C=UA/ST=Ukraine/L=Zakarpattia/O=dima/CN=CAwebserver\";\n\
CRTSUBJ=\"/C=UA/ST=Ukraine/L=Zakarpattia/O=dima/CN=CRTwebserver\";\n\
# Generate CA (Certificate Authority)\n\
openssl ecparam -genkey -name prime256v1 -out ca.key;\n\
openssl req -new -x509 -days 365 -key ca.key -out ca.pem -subj \$CASUBJ;\n\
# Generate server certificate\n\
openssl ecparam -genkey -name prime256v1 -out key.pem;\n\
openssl req -new -key key.pem -out csr.pem -subj \$CRTSUBJ;\n\
# Sign the public key\n\
openssl x509 -req -days 365 -in csr.pem -CA ca.pem -CAkey ca.key -set_serial 01 -out cert.pem;" \
>generator.bash && chmod +x generator.bash && bash generator.bashThen, in order to run the server, navigate to the website's home directory and run commands.

To protect your server from hackers:
- Create a user for the webserver and use native linux protections to prevent users from accessing non-server files and directories
- Avoid allowing users to create symlinks. They can escape their sandbox root directory and potentially get into other user's directory
- Make sure that other services that have access to this server's directories won't execute or process in a way that could compromise the security of the machine files that users can create and modify
